Transaction f27643d7921b8c51b422e0fe69d232c1ad53b182e602016c044f6805107da014

1 Input
2 Outputs
  • f27643d7921b8c51b422e0fe69d232c1ad53b182e602016c044f6805107da014:0
  • value  2474574
    address  16CdUPfDEE8L62rE4L4AxyQ4Cg3j7sDwvg
  • f27643d7921b8c51b422e0fe69d232c1ad53b182e602016c044f6805107da014:1
  • value  2480000
    address  1LM9GA7x2pEtGj6ecBkiX3EfX4aLxQ1j4z